I just noticed in Live View under Firewall traffic on the WAN interaface going to 172.28.195.1:4455.
Source shows my WAN's IP-address:64xxx with the xxx increasing every second.

Oddly enough, after port 64556 it turned to 53913 and start going up again.

172.28.195.1 is a private address. But I don't even use that private address range in my network.
What is this?

Here is discussion about the Tobii eye-tracking device
https://developer.tobii.com/community/forums/topic/network-sessions-with-rex-tcpip-driver/
where their SW seems to regularly try to connect to this address:port
"Yes, every second, the C:\Program Files (x86)\Tobii\Service\tobii.Service.exe tries hard to reach out to 172.28.195.1:4455 (which, of course, does not exist in most networks)."

You wouldn't happen to have something like this running?

Actually, I do. The device is not plugged in atm (bought a new monitor a while back) but the software is installed.
I'll read that link and disable the software for now.
